Sm Loratadine Side Effects
This medication is generally well-tolerated, with no common side effects typically reported. However, if you experience any unusual symptoms, it is important to consult a healthcare professional. Serious allergic reactions to this medication are rare, but immediate medical attention is necessary if you encounter symptoms such as a rash, itching, swelling (particularly of the face, tongue, or throat), severe dizziness, or difficulty breathing.
Although these reactions are infrequent, being vigilant about any changes in your health is crucial. If you experience side effects not mentioned here, seeking advice from a healthcare provider is recommended. Remember, the list provided is not exhaustive, and any new or concerning symptoms should be discussed with a medical professional to ensure your safety and well-being.

What is SM loratadine used for?
Loratadine is an antihistamine used to relieve symptoms of allergy, such as runny nose, sneezing, itchy or watery eyes, and itching of the nose or throat. It is also used to treat hives and itching in people with chronic skin reactions.
Is loratadine the same as Claritin?
Yes, loratadine is the generic name for the brand name drug Claritin. They contain the same active ingredient and are used to treat allergy symptoms.
What is loratadine 10mg used for?
Loratadine 10mg is used to relieve symptoms associated with allergies, such as runny nose, sneezing, itchy or watery eyes, and itching of the throat or nose. It is also used to treat hives and itching in individuals with chronic skin reactions.
What is the most common side effect of loratadine?
The most common side effect of loratadine is drowsiness. However, it is generally considered to be non-sedating compared to other antihistamines. Other possible side effects include headache, dry mouth, and fatigue.
What is the safest antihistamine to take long term?
When considering long-term use of antihistamines, second-generation antihistamines are generally preferred due to their improved safety profile and reduced sedative effects compared to first-generation antihistamines. Loratadine (Claritin) and cetirizine (Zyrtec) are commonly recommended for long-term use as they are less likely to cause drowsiness and have fewer side effects. However, it is important for individuals to consult with a healthcare provider to determine the most appropriate option based on their specific health needs and conditions.
